Almost 400 Ukrainian drones destroyed across Russia in single night
A total of 389 Ukrainian drones have been downed over Russian territory overnight, including 56 in Leningrad Region, the Defense Ministry in Moscow has said

TL;DR
- Russia's Defense Ministry claims 389 Ukrainian drones were shot down overnight across 14 regions and Crimea.
- Leningrad Region reported 56 drones destroyed, leading to a fire in Ust-Luga's port and damage to a residential building in Vyborg.
- Flights at St. Petersburg's Pulkovo Airport were temporarily halted due to the drone incursions.
- Bryansk Region intercepted 113 drones.
- Ukrainian drone raids have intensified since mid-March, targeting infrastructure.
- Russian officials describe the raids as "terrorist attacks" and have retaliated with strikes on Ukrainian infrastructure.
